@rafrombrc rafrombrc released this Dec 31, 2015 · 318 commits to dev since this release

At long last, the Heka v0.10.0 final release. Contains all of the fixes and new features in the v0.10.0 beta releases, plus an additional LogstreamerInput bug fix for cases where log files of zero length are deleted and recreated out from under the log watcher. Full details in changelog.

8dc72f5be664ef1659b6009c1b9ca3df heka_0.10.0_amd64.deb
6f9d181bc9b57e17f9f3cce0ee275a58 heka_0.10.0_i386.deb
a5d0793b652fe93ae32a2a9bf0baf6c8 heka-0_10_0-linux-386.rpm
b740055611f9e1d3b92f19d2b55d8782 heka-0_10_0-linux-386.tar.gz
4793867493e10434709a6e88eebca91f heka-0_10_0-linux-amd64.rpm
89ff62fe2ccad3d462c9951de0c15e38 heka-0_10_0-linux-amd64.tar.gz
9985dc8ba9885c52b56bfef5bbff238f heka-0_10_0-darwin-amd64.dmg

@rafrombrc rafrombrc released this Nov 24, 2015 · 324 commits to dev since this release

Third Heka 0.10.0 beta release. Highlights include:

  • TcpOutput now supports closing / reopening connections after a configurable number of succesfully delivered messages.
  • Added decoders for parsing Linux's "netstat" and "netdev" output (i.e. contents of /proc/net/netstat, /proc/net/snmp, and /proc/net/net/dev files).
  • All decoders can now suppress decode failure error messages if desired.
  • Many, many bugfixes, including some significant ones related to the newly added disk buffering behaviour.

As always, full details are available in the changelog.

972df57dfa233b40c341aef6b34d094d heka_0.10.0b2_i386.deb
34b5a1cc968c903c6e6582173c34bbd6 heka-0_10_0b2-linux-386.rpm
d2160ff729c64d0e9973482b60c139ad heka-0_10_0b2-linux-386.tar.gz
fcce7fb7d4e30b56d599aef425848b2e heka_0.10.0b2_amd64.deb
ff5bebc519123bb89ed0e3fe427b1cd8 heka-0_10_0b2-linux-amd64.rpm
1ed77a1cd60ea42e1e94d5fd0c1eb739 heka-0_10_0b2-linux-amd64.tar.gz
59fbe2a0111744cdd595dcc6d76c33e9 heka-0_10_0b2-darwin-amd64.dmg

@rafrombrc rafrombrc released this Aug 17, 2015 · 462 commits to dev since this release

The second beta leading up to a Heka 0.10.0 release. Details in changelog.

MD5 Checksums:

f603b78fa706a8ed3792bbb772123b4c heka_0.10.0b1_i386.deb
4132f93e5ea5e2a2a13b78472bf6c525 heka_0.10.0b1_amd64.deb
5c20ab63eaf0ac20973bf92f40f58627 heka-0_10_0b1-linux-386.rpm
52e71ff8b8913b91bf7730161862ebad heka-0_10_0b1-linux-amd64.rpm
38f57b7abd81ef84b29cd89b1c5d7656 heka-0_10_0b1-linux-386.tar.gz
451db4df6ee3a4a1e127d1fe5ee4f293 heka-0_10_0b1-linux-amd64.tar.gz
25de95751fcee95dc22266995945fc4b heka-0_10_0b1-darwin-amd64.dmg

@rafrombrc rafrombrc released this Jul 14, 2015 · 507 commits to dev since this release

First beta release of Heka version 0.10.0. This features a complete overhaul of the filter and output plugin APIs, along with a temporary transitional API for both plugin types to ease the migration process.

The new APIs simplify plugin implementations, and allow Heka to support disk buffering for all filter and output plugins. Details on the many additional features and fixes are available in the changelog.

MD5 Hashes:
ac42ee601d9585633ff4e9cb96a03ee6 heka_0.10.0b0_amd64.deb
89d9245742999915d513d1c4e9fa1b28 heka_0.10.0b0_i386.deb
45225228cd2c5166a2c4690f0e17ef7a heka-0_10_0b0-linux-386.rpm
14c4e6b55a5df1158c96cd30caee65b7 heka-0_10_0b0-linux-386.tar.gz
5dd4c6e50165a7e8f451ebcf24faeec6 heka-0_10_0b0-linux-amd64.rpm
d09d30eca0d87c77907b44b1766a24f6 heka-0_10_0b0-linux-amd64.tar.gz
c613970a86720370cb506e31a8f3dfc2 heka-0_10_0b0-darwin-amd64.dmg

@rafrombrc rafrombrc released this Apr 22, 2015 · 739 commits to dev since this release

Less bugs, more fixes! Details in changelog.

MD5 Hashes:
8d08023d5fb31d0bb46d7943c5e1aca9 heka_0.9.2_amd64.deb
56e1eb3f92d6b6e93bf5dee56d49f71b heka_0.9.2_i386.deb
886a561c79dc09cdd04aa50c8fceed40 heka-0_9_2-linux-386.rpm
e345f2f84dfdd390ad4d164886859242 heka-0_9_2-linux-386.tar.gz
efabe8e501f410a38e5e7e07ee095538 heka-0_9_2-linux-amd64.rpm
864625dff702306eba1494149ff903ee heka-0_9_2-linux-amd64.tar.gz
0fb485a619bcb6cbaade86ec3b302411 heka-0_9_2-darwin-amd64.dmg

@rafrombrc rafrombrc released this Mar 13, 2015 · 774 commits to dev since this release

Includes some bug fixes and a couple of new features that didn't quite make it in to the v0.9.0 release. See changelog for details.

MD5 hashes:
0d07dfeb4690d9f58cce7dcc687e9faa heka_0.9.1_amd64.deb
13cd3c87f5f1c7d77781994e4162fad6 heka_0.9.1_i386.deb
c0c25037bda998d5049f945a4796ce0d heka-0_9_1-linux-386.rpm
104d315922ca4262c42ae8a8f9de8890 heka-0_9_1-linux-386.tar.gz
5ca597b943fd1a4b71b9366ce7c1b7db heka-0_9_1-linux-amd64.rpm
f5e7eea7eb987c817254086787d55a72 heka-0_9_1-linux-amd64.tar.gz
c526e58873d8c42775c76bf4593498b2 heka-0_9_1-darwin-amd64.dmg

@rafrombrc rafrombrc released this Feb 26, 2015 · 804 commits to dev since this release

The Heka 0.9.0 release has lots of new fixes and features. And, in the name of progress, there are a handful of breaking changes, so please read the changelog carefully before you upgrade! Some highlights:

  • We've introduced "splitter" plugins, which handle the task of deciding where to slice input streams so as to generate discrete Heka messages.
  • The config loading has been improved, so Heka now automatically extracts decoder and splitter settings from an input plugin's configuration and makes them available to the input through an improved API.
  • It is now possible to use shared Lua libraries with the Lua sandbox.
  • It is also now possible to write input and output plugins using Lua.
  • Heka message protocol buffer encoding and decoding is now available within the Lua sandbox.
  • ElasticSearch output now supports disk buffering to prevent message loss when ElasticSearch is unavailable.
  • Disk buffering for ElasticSearch and TcpOutput now supports a maximum queue size, with the ability to specify what should happen when the maximum size is reached.

e4a65a755cf6ebdf7fc794935196a68b heka_0.9.0_amd64.deb
bb9d66970cf8130ae3b7aa0846e93beb heka_0.9.0_i386.deb
c2ccc65d26a29822a845d8fc29b59244 heka-0_9_0-linux-386.rpm
13645593203a816eda36d6d78b0fadb7 heka-0_9_0-linux-386.tar.gz
34831dd03bd04973b7927c7d9db141e1 heka-0_9_0-linux-amd64.rpm
6a7f94f2efc3101cfb95d73f23882bdb heka-0_9_0-linux-amd64.tar.gz
664e49565efeb2d60686f2f084f1b19f heka-0_9_0-darwin-amd64.dmg

Unfortunately a bug related to linking C and Go code on Windows has made it impossible for us to provide a Windows build for this release. We hope that this will be resolved soon.

@rafrombrc rafrombrc released this Jan 8, 2015 · 1123 commits to dev since this release

Fixes parallel decoding across multiple Logstreams in a single LogstreamerInput.

MD5 Checksums:
57f3c9420cdfabf63c47e303ba7ef714 heka_0.8.3_amd64.deb
05f4bccc0020dd3b147c18c5fb275482 heka_0.8.3_i386.deb
d6f3c5164ab0fe8f9dd64f244162ebd2 heka-0_8_3-linux-386.rpm
66b41fa9df551fdcc251cda145babe8c heka-0_8_3-linux-386.tar.gz
1ee60d65d692e2fb630e4c1da8112792 heka-0_8_3-linux-amd64.rpm
d23d0e599263b5111bf310fbea838ff3 heka-0_8_3-linux-amd64.tar.gz
4f767752fe1446faf380fbd3d8213bb0 heka-0_8_3-darwin-amd64.dmg

@rafrombrc rafrombrc released this Jan 6, 2015 · 1128 commits to dev since this release

Removed inadvertent GeoIP library dependency, see changelog.

MD5 Checksums:

a593859e15ecca9350b3d2b17aee7948 heka_0.8.2_i386.deb
dbd0b6151a7ce912a97440733b9a98b9 heka_0.8.2_amd64.deb
fafe9c1ce1d7899c45937a0cf0a40a13 heka-0_8_2-linux-386.rpm
618a74c6604ac8d447ccdae95e68c341 heka-0_8_2-linux-amd64.rpm
2f74b721a72131c47c3143e21455badf heka-0_8_2-linux-386.tar.gz
d78e2b557cb44060a5bbc118d841da09 heka-0_8_2-linux-amd64.tar.gz
6eb454b9df86c958a3b65f9262bc7d63 heka-0_8_2-darwin-amd64.dmg

